From July 7-8, 2022, the DigitalFuture Summit (DFS) will take place at ESMT Berlin in a hybrid format. Around 1,000 young professionals and students from over 100 universities and more than 40 countries will join 24 partner companies to discuss the opportunities and hurdles of the digital future.
Following the recommendation of the nomination committee, which includes members of ESMT faculty, academic board, and supervisory board, the supervisory board of ESMT Berlin has extended the contract of ESMT president Prof. Jörg Rocholl, PhD, for five more years. Additionally, Jörg Rocholl has been named chair of the steering committee of the Global Network for Advanced Management (GNAM), a network of 32 renowned business schools spanning six continents and founded by Yale School of Management ten years ago.
As of July 1, Prof. Per Olsson will hold the Deutsche Post DHL Group Professorship in Sustainable Accounting at ESMT Berlin. The professorship will focus on the measuring and reporting of ESG components within accounting. The inauguration event will be held at ESMT on October 12, 2022.
